  Do I need to submit any paperwork or supporting documentation?
You will need to mail in the signature document 1040ME-EL within seven days of receiving acknowledgement that you have been accepted.

If you do not chose to, or can not, participate in the Federal PIN Program, you will be required to mail in the 8453-OL federal signature document.

If you owe, you may need to mail in a payment voucher with your payment.

OnLine Taxes will provide these forms for you to print out and mail in if applicable.
